Alright, I think it's time for some CLARIFICATION. NARYAR STYLE.

You consistently build your chassis too big. And you don't listen to all of our advice. It doesn't help your bot, it wastes weight in 99% of cases, weight that is wasted instead of being used on more interesting things.

Fit your component mass to your chassis instead of just building a chassis and then putting components in it.

Or you can judge the chassis size needed for when you have an idea what components you are going to put it in there but that is more for advanced builders.

Have you checked the Tutorials section ? You should.

And about chassis height, if you click the chassis height ruler just one pixel under the end you'll achieve minimum possible height. But we're talking about length and width and that generally this bot will be served much more by a T-shaped chassis.
